It is that time - KFC double downs are BACK.
The chicken-y cheesy creations have returned to the menu for a limited time, and as well as the OG, there's two new ways to double down in town.
The Korean Mayo and Cheesy Hash flavours are a couple of twists on the cult classic.
The Korean Mayo edition is a ‘bolder and spicier’ choice, with two zinger fillets, bacon, cheese and spicy korean mayo.
Not a fan of the extra kick? Cheesy Hash might be more a bitta you.
It has the two zinger fillets, bacon, cheesy sauce, and they’ve smacked a hash brown in right the middle of the lot.
